Arianne Hartono Named SEC Player of the Week

1/31/2018 | Women's Tennis

Jan. 31, 2018

BIRMINGHAM, Ala. - Ole Miss women's tennis senior Arianne Hartono has been named the SEC Player of the Week, the conference office announced Wednesday.

This marks the first time for Hartono to be named SEC Player of the Week. She was named Freshman of the Week in 2015.

Quick Hits…
• Went 5-0 in singles and doubles to help lead the Rebels to a 3-0 start, including two wins at the ITA Kick-Off.
• Clinched the season opener at Purdue.
• Against TCU won her match at No. 1 singles in straight sets to set up her teammate for the clinch.
• Defeated the No. 20 ranked doubles team and the No. 21 ranked singles player in straight sets to help the Rebels knock off No. 15 Oklahoma State in the championship match of the ITA Kick-Off and snap the Cowgirls 37-home match win streak.
• The Rebels advanced to the National Team Indoor for the second year in a row.
• Improved to 12-4 overall in singles and 11-5 in doubles.

The Rebels, who jumped eight spots to No. 15 in this week's Oracle/ITA Rankings, will host Memphis to kick off a doubleheader Saturday at 12 p.m. at the new Ole Miss Indoor Tennis Center, located near the Manning Center.
